Pennsylvania Code § 8-1194

Penalty.
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
A member of council who, by vote, appoints any person to the police force or as a fire apparatus operator contrary to the provisions of this subchapter, or a member of council or member of the commission who willfully refuses to comply with or conform to the provisions of this subchapter, commits a misdemeanor and, upon conviction, shall be sentenced to pay a fine not exceeding $100 or to imprisonment not exceeding 90 days, or both.
